Output 84b6921882421704ff7ed2e91d72a49fd7d427a911d320ab7d71aabd0d208d61:1

value
626066
script pubkey
OP_0 OP_PUSHBYTES_20 e824bdc2a8b33c3ccd0225936ed4972d2dc1cb9a
address
ltc1qaqjtms4gkv7rengzykfka4yh95kurju67ss9dy
transaction
84b6921882421704ff7ed2e91d72a49fd7d427a911d320ab7d71aabd0d208d61
spent
true